My Buying Guides on Electric Fuel Pump 12v

What I Look for First

When I shop for an electric fuel pump 12v, I always start with compatibility. I make sure the pump matches my vehicle’s engine type, fuel system, and pressure requirements. If I choose the wrong pump, it can cause poor performance, hard starting, or even engine damage.

Fuel Pressure and Flow Rate

For me, the two most important specs are fuel pressure and flow rate. I check the PSI or bar rating to be sure it fits my engine’s needs. I also look at gallons per hour or liters per hour so I know the pump can deliver enough fuel under load. I avoid pumps that are too weak or unnecessarily powerful for my setup.

Carbureted vs. Fuel-Injected Engines

I always pay attention to whether my engine is carbureted or fuel-injected. Carbureted engines usually need lower pressure, while fuel-injected systems need much higher pressure and more precise delivery. Using the wrong type can create serious problems, so this is one of the first things I verify.

Build Quality and Materials

I prefer pumps made from durable materials like aluminum, stainless steel, or high-grade composites. Since the pump is exposed to heat, vibration, and fuel, I want something that feels solid and reliable. In my experience, better build quality usually means longer service life.

Noise Level

I also consider how noisy the pump is. Some electric fuel pumps are louder than others, and if I’m installing one in a daily driver, I usually want a quieter model. A noisy pump can be annoying and may also hint at poor design or wear over time.

Installation Ease

I like a pump that is easy to install, especially if I’m doing the work myself. I look for clear instructions, included fittings, mounting hardware, and wiring support. A straightforward installation saves me time and reduces the chance of mistakes.

Power Consumption and Wiring

Because it runs on 12v, I check the electrical requirements carefully. I make sure my wiring, relay, fuse, and connectors can handle the pump safely. I never want to overload the circuit or create a fire risk, so I treat this as a critical step.

Compatibility with Fuel Type

I always confirm that the pump is suitable for the fuel I use. Some pumps are designed for gasoline only, while others can handle ethanol blends, diesel, or race fuel. If I use the wrong pump for the fuel type, it may wear out quickly or fail altogether.

Reliability and Brand Reputation

When I buy an electric fuel pump 12v, I trust brands with a strong reputation and good customer feedback. I look at reviews to see how the pump performs after months of use, not just on day one. Reliability matters more to me than a low price if I want peace of mind.

Price vs. Value

I try not to choose only the cheapest option. Instead, I compare price with features, warranty, durability, and performance. In my experience, a mid-range pump with solid quality often gives me better value than a bargain model that fails early.

Warranty and Support

I always check the warranty before I buy. A good warranty tells me the manufacturer stands behind the product. I also like it when customer support is easy to reach in case I need help with installation or troubleshooting.
